Invitation for Construction Bid: Facade and Roof Repair & Window Replacement-SPHPI
First published Thursday, January 26, 2023
Project Description
The School of Public Health and Psychiatric Institute (SPHPI) consists of a twelve-story building located on the west side of UICs campus. Built in 1957, it was originally used as a hospital and is currently utilized for animal research, education, and administration.
Facade: Rebuild damaged bricks that have been pulled away from existing masonry substrate, replace damaged steel lintels, tuckpoint 100% of the building.
Roof: Replace all fourteen (14) roof-areas with Modified Bitumen Roofing System and R30 insulation.
Window/Interior: Replace all 626 windows with fixed insulated energy efficient windows. Repair all finishes that have been damaged by moisture / water.
Curtain wall / Storefront: Wet-seal 100% of the curtain wall. Replace storefront at the west-end and at the south side of the building.
This Project is located at: School of Public Health and Psychiatric Institute is located at 1601 West Taylor Street.
